DELL XPS 9365 9365-1486 Overview
The DELL XPS 9365-1486 is a versatile and powerful hybrid laptop that offers a sleek design and impressive performance. Powered by a 7th generation Intel Core i5 processor with 2 cores and 4 threads, this laptop provides a seamless multitasking experience. The processor has a base frequency of 1.20 GHz and can boost up to 3.2 GHz, ensuring smooth operation even with demanding tasks.
The laptop comes with 8 GB of LPDDR3 RAM and a 256 GB SSD, providing ample storage space and fast data access. The beautiful 13.3-inch Quad HD IPS display with Gorilla Glass offers stunning visuals with a resolution of 3200 x 1800 pixels and a pixel density of 276 ppi. The InfinityEdge bezel technology makes the screen feel immersive, while the touchscreen capability adds convenience and ease of use.
Despite its compact size and lightweight design, the DELL XPS 9365-1486 is packed with connectivity options. It features Wi-Fi 5 (802.11ac), Bluetooth 4.2, a Thunderbolt 3 port with PowerShare support, USB Type-C ports, a combo headphone/mic port, and a card reader for added versatility. The backlit keyboard and touchpad provide comfortable typing and navigation, while the MaxxAudio Pro audio system delivers high-quality sound through dual speakers.
The laptop also includes a front HD camera with a wide-angle lens, as well as sensors like an accelerometer, electronic compass, and gyroscope for enhanced functionality. The 46 Wh lithium-ion battery offers up to 15 hours of battery life, allowing users to stay productive on the go.
